<h2id="working-with-ids">Working with IDS</h2>
<p>Blockstack allows you to create one free identity in the Blockstack
<em>namespace</em>. A namespace a top-level category in the Blockstack Ecosystem. A
namespace is similar to the domains you are familiar with from using the web,
<codeclass="highlighter-rouge">google.com</code> is domain and so is the <codeclass="highlighter-rouge">gouvernement.fr</code> domain. An identity in
the <codeclass="highlighter-rouge">.blockstack</code> namespace has the <em><codeclass="highlighter-rouge">username</code></em><codeclass="highlighter-rouge">.id.blockstack</code> format.</p>
<p>You can also purchase your own identity (<codeclass="highlighter-rouge">.id</code>) using bitcoin (BTC). A name’s price depends on its length in characters and the current Bitcoin fees. For example, ranges such as .00831 and .001943 BTC 20-80 US dollars is not unusual.</p>
